Friday, February 16, 2018 - I'm a fan of Kirk Venge and regularly purchase his wines. However, I really didn't enjoy this bottle. This blend of 66% Zinfandel, 16% Charbono, 14% Petit Syrah and 4% Syrah has a dark purple color and a fruity nose of dark berries and oak. It tastes of cherries, plums, licorice, and cedar. It's high alcohol content is very notable in its aromas and taste. I agree with others that it tastes too sweet and port like. I was told by the Venge staff that Scout's Honor should be consumed early and not cellared, so perhaps it lost something by waiting. I think that it's fruit lost its freshness and clarity. I tried the same bottle at a tasting years ago and enjoyed it much more.
